On Fri, Jan 20, 2012 at 02:23:15PM +0100, Corinna Vinschen wrote:
> [Moved to cygwin-apps for discussion]
>
> On Jan 20 09:49, marco atzeri wrote:
> > As rebaseall is almost mandatory on W7/64 and
> > we are always suggesting it to anyone with fork problem,
> > I think a simple batch file in the / (called rebase.bat ?)
> > similar to the cygwin.bat
> >
> > with something like
> > -------------------------------------
> > C:
> > chdir C:\cygwin\bin
> > C:\cygwin\bin\dash -l -i -c "rebaseall"
> > --------------------------------------
> >
> Sounds like an interesting idea. That would simplify the description
> in the User's Guide, too. The only problem I see with this is the
> fact that rebaseall exits prematurely if more than just dash or ash
> processes are running. Maybe we should add a flag to rebaseall so
> that it waits for a keypress in that case.
How should the batch file determine the Cygwin installation location?
Just assuming "C:\cygwin" will not work for everyone.
